Benefits and Features
Integrated Temperature Sensor Enables Simultaneous
Dual Temperature (Remote and Local) Measurements
Remote Accuracy ±1°C
Local Accuracy ±2°C from +60°C to +100°C
Measures Remote Temperature up to +150°C
0.25°C Resolution
Dual Zone Monitoring Automates Over-Temperature
Alarms
Programmable Remote/Local Temperature
Thresholds
ALERT Output
Small Footprint
3mm x 3mm TDFN Package with Exposed Pad
Low Thermal Mass Reduces Measurement Latency

General Description
The MAX6642 precise, two-channel digital temperature
sensor accurately measures the temperature of its own
die and a remote PN junction and reports the tempera-
ture data over a 2-wire serial interface. The remote PN
junction is typically a substrate PNP transistor on the
die of a CPU, ASIC, GPU, or FPGA. The remote PN
junction can also be a discrete diode-connected small-
signal transistor.
The 2-wire serial interface accepts standard system
management bus (SMBus™), Write Byte, Read Byte,
Send Byte, and Receive Byte commands to read the
temperature data and to program the alarm thresholds.
To enhance system reliability, the MAX6642 includes an
SMBus timeout. The temperature data format is 10 bit
with the least significant bit (LSB) corresponding to
+0.25°C. The
ALERT
output asserts when the local or
remote overtemperature thresholds are violated. A fault
queue may be used to prevent the
ALERT
output from
setting until two consecutive faults have been detected.
Measurements can be done autonomously or in a sin-
gle-shot mode.
Remote accuracy is ±1°C maximum error between
+60°C and +100°C. The MAX6642 operates from -40°C
to +125°C, and measures remote temperatures
between 0°C and +150°C. The MAX6642 is available in
a 6-pin TDFN package with an exposed pad.
